标签: javascript unicode
我正在使用Html 5开发一个跨浏览器/平台应用程序。我正在使用contentEditable进行文本插入。我在画布上绘制用户插入的文本。当用户输入笑脸符号(在我的情况下来自Nexus 7)时,我无法获得这些字符的宽度。
我将每个角色放在一个不可见的div中(我已放置在一些负坐标处)并获得div的宽度和高度。
有什么办法可以删除用户插入的笑脸吗?
该应用程序还支持其他语言,如中文,日语等,所以我不能检查charCode,除非这些特殊字符有特定范围的unicode。
提前致谢。